## Digest Scheduling — Onboarding Notes

Batch email digests run via Cranewell's `digestd` service. Three windows: 06:00, 12:00, 18:00 local. Scheduling changes require a config PR plus sign-off at the weekly eng sync — no ad-hoc edits. Missed windows auto-retry once after 15 minutes, then drop to the dead-letter queue. Check the queue before declaring an incident. Dashboards linked in the repo README. Agenda items for sync go to the list below.

billing contact of kagag-bagep = ulaax@orvexcloud.example

## Runbook: query planner regression

If release metrics show the Saltmire reporting queries suddenly going full-scan, you're probably looking at the planner regression from the stats-sampling change. First step: freeze the rollout and re-run `ANALYZE` on the affected tables via the Plannerscope tool. If plans don't recover within ten minutes, roll back the planner flag. Plannerscope talks to the internal stats service and needs the key below.

service key, kageg-yagep: zpat11_eqeO8gygq4O

## Session handling for the Parcelino tracking webhook

Quick overview for review: the Parcelino webhook doesn't use cookies at all. Each delivery event carries a short-lived session stamp, rotated every 15 minutes by the Courierloop scheduler. Replays outside the window are rejected with a 409, and we log the stamp hash, never the stamp itself. To verify signature checks end to end, send a test event using the bearer token below.

session JWT of yawep-yawep = eyJhbGciOiJIUzI1NiIsInR5cCI6IkpXVCJ9.eyJzdWIiOiI3pWF3_In0.aXYsHiog

Service accounts for the Bracken consent banner rollout. Banner config lives in the Tansy service; the rollout job runs under svc-bracken-deploy with read-write on region flags only. Do not reuse this account for analytics. Rotation is quarterly. Staging and prod use separate accounts; never cross them. For API calls from the rollout pipeline to Tansy, authenticate with the key below.

gateway credential: kto3_qfe